In the app / drivers

Record a pickup

3 stepsAbout 3 minutesDriver

The pickup capture is three facts: how much, what it looks like, where you are. The button stays grey until all three are in, and poor signal never loses the record.
1

Open the capture

From the card’s Record pickup band, the form asks for tonnes loaded and the vehicle registration. The reg carries over from dispatch, so correct it if the truck changed.
The pickup form: tonnes, reg, photo, location, and the readiness strip.
2

Photo, then location

Photo of loaded material opens the camera. Photograph the load, not people. Then Capture GPS location. The readiness strip ticks off tonnes, photo and location, and Record pickup A unlocks when all three are in.
Everything in: the readiness strip complete, the button (A) live.
3

Press it once, signal or none

No coverage at the pit? Keep going: the draft lives on the phone, and when you press the button the record applies exactly once when coverage returns. If an earlier attempt already got through, the app says so, and nothing is duplicated. The success screen hands you Directions to the destination.
